Skip to content

Cart

Your cart is empty

Large French Art Deco Mirror Photo Frame C168

Sale price£125.00

Large French Art Deco Mirror Photo Frame with pretty detail.

Measurements: 30cm height by 24cm width.

Ref: C168

Large French Art Deco Mirror Photo Frame  C168
Large French Art Deco Mirror Photo Frame C168 Sale price£125.00